so funny - I actually have a list going of some non-lovey dovey male/female duets for something I'm working on with a friend. Here are some of my faves:
Two of A Kind from Lippa Wild Party. Yeah, they're a couple, but the song can be done hella-platonically, in fact I first saw a gay friend and his fag-hag (sorry if I offend, but I am one, so I'm allowed, lol) perform it and it was so perfect for their friendship. It's really really cute and very character for the female.
Goodbye Until Tomorrow/I Could Never Rescue You from L5Y. You dont' really sing a lot together - it's the closing song and you're not singing TO each other - but it's still beautiful and I love it.
People Like Us from LaChuisa Wild Party. More serious and intense, borderline romantic, but can still be done as just two people singing it.
Two Lost Souls from Damn Yankees. This one's fun and unromantic.
Stud/Babe from I Love You, You're Perfect, Now Change - amazing! and so funny!
Old Friends from Merrily We Roll Along. Written as a trio but can easily be tweaked and completely platonic.
Unworthy of Your Love from Assassins. Romantic in nature but not sung to each other, sung about others...one of my faves.
Eddie and Mae from LaChuisa Wild Party - same couple as Two of A Kind, different version, lol. Still kinda fun, definitely not romantic...give it a listen.
An Old Fashioned Wedding from Annie Get Your Gun is fun too and no worry about romantic stuff there.
